编程的门槛高不高怎么看

时间:2025-01-25 03:58:28 游戏攻略

编程的门槛 因人而异,但总体来说,可以认为它有一定的门槛,但并非高不可攀。以下是一些关于编程门槛的观点:

技术知识 :编程需要掌握多种编程语言和相关工具,如C、C++、Java、Python等,并熟悉这些语言的语法和特性。此外,对于常用的算法和数据结构,如排序、查找、链表、树等,也需要有一定的了解和掌握。

逻辑思维:

编程是一个逻辑性较强的工作,需要应聘者具备清晰、准确的思维能力。在解决问题时,能够分析问题的本质,找出问题的关键点,并设计出合理的解决方案。

解决问题的能力:

编程工作中,需要能够快速定位问题所在,并采取有效的方法解决问题。这要求应聘者具备良好的问题分析和解决能力,能够利用自己的技术知识和经验,找到问题的根源并提出解决方案。

沟通能力:

编程工作中,往往需要与团队成员、领导和用户等进行沟通。良好的沟通能力能够帮助应聘者更好地与他人合作,共同完成工作任务。

数学能力:

编程涉及到算法和逻辑,因此具备良好的数学基础能够帮助你更好地理解和应用编程知识。特别是对于一些较为复杂的编程问题,数学能力会成为解决问题的重要工具。

计算机操作基础:

对于完全没有接触过计算机的初学者来说,了解计算机的基本操作是必不可少的。包括如何开启计算机、使用操作系统、安装程序等。

学习能力和自学能力:

编程是一项需要不断学习和实践的技能,掌握一门编程语言只是入门的第一步。需要保持学习的态度,善于利用互联网资源,自学相关的编程知识和技能。

持之以恒的动力和兴趣:

入门编程需要一定的时间和精力投入,因此拥有持之以恒的动力和对编程的兴趣是非常重要的。只有保持学习的热情和耐心,才能不断进步并享受编程带来的成就感。

综合以上几点,可以认为编程的门槛主要包括扎实的技术知识、良好的逻辑思维能力、解决问题的能力和良好的沟通能力。入门编程的门槛相对较低,但要想成为一名优秀的程序员,还需要不断学习和实践,积累经验。

建议

对于初学者,可以先从一门编程语言入手,逐步掌握基本的语法和编程思想。

通过实际项目或编程练习来提高自己的问题解决能力和编程技能。

培养良好的学习习惯和自学能力,以便能够持续跟进新技术和工具的发展。

保持对编程的兴趣和热情,不断挑战自己,提升自己的技术水平。